Port Orange restaurant under Dunlawton Bridge on Intracoastal Waterway Being a native of the Daytona Beach and Port Orannge area, it's easy for me to forget how much fun can be had, in such a close proximity to my home in Port Orange. Just a 5 minute drive from my home, is not only the beautiful Atlantic Ocean, but some great restaurants and public docks, underneath the Dunlawton bridge.

This weekend, my husband and I decided to have a casual dinner at Our Deck Down Under.view of docks and birds on Intracoastal Waterway

This Port Orange restaurant is located directly on the Intracoastal Waterway, with indoor and outdoor dining. I had a full pound of delicious crab legs.

 

After dinner we took a walk around the area and ran into family and friends, while enjoying the tranquil views and relaxing environment.

There are two other fresh seafood restaurants located in this little haven under the bridge.

DJ's Deck is a quaint place with casual outdoor dining.DJs Deck restaurant in Port Orange on the Intracoastal Waterway

King's Seafood is another Port Orange restaurant under the Dunlawton bridge, that has beautiful artwork painted directly on the building, including a mermaid, King Triton, a heron catching a fish, and a leatherback turtle that is very close to making it OFF the endangered species list!

Ines? It's the Daytona Beach area. Many people don't realize there are actually about 7 different cities clustered together, all in what people think is Daytona Beach. Port Orange is 10 minutes south of the actual Daytona Beach line. Daytona is the older section in this area. When people think they want to move to Daytona, they actually, usually prefer Port Orange or Ormond Beach, where everything is newer. I cover the entire area, and then some :P
